New Delhi: The advent of smartphones has increased convenience, but also increased difficulties. Smartphone users need to be vigilant. Google has warned that iPhones and Android phones are being attacked. Millions of spam messages are being sent daily in the US and Europe. These messages are designed to defraud you. Your phone is not secure. Therefore, it is important to remain vigilant and identify these fraudulent messages to avoid being scammed.
Furthermore, Google has stated that Android’s security measures block more spam calls each month, while Apple’s offer less protection. Let’s understand what types of messages spam are and how you could be scammed.
